Scribble Flower Twofer

 

I've got cards today for Darnell's Twofer challenge where the prompt is Flowers.  I had pulled out my Taylored Expressions Scribble Flowers dies for a recent challenge and while I was making those cards I had the spark of an idea for the Twofer challenge.  For the first card I used the dies to create a simple flower in a frame.  For the second card I took part of the flower and created a fun polka dot background with it.  It's bright and cheery and maybe even a bit silly but overall it has a fun and celebratory feel to it I think.

Circle Twofer



Last time I tried to play along with Darnell's Twofer challenge I missed the deadline so this time I'm determined to get in there before it's too late!  
WPlus9's Doodle Buds set has a few different flower shapes in it including this fun circle.  On my first card I used it as it was intended as a flower.  I thought, however, that it would also make a fun balloon so I created some bright and happy birthday balloons for the second card.  I used some baker's twine for the string and added a fun, curly happy birthday sentiment.

Twofer Flowers


Aaaargh!!!  I just realised I've missed the deadline for the Twofer challenge!!!  
This time the prompt was flowers and I'm so excited about what I came up with but I came up with them a day late.

*sigh*  

Oh well.  I'm going to share them anyway.

I chose a flower from Altenew's simple flower set.  I started by making a thank you card with a simple bunch of flowers.  Then I was looking at the swirl on the flower and it made me think of the snail card I made for a recent CASology challenge.  So I took the body of a snail from an Essentials by Ellen set and then used the flower to make him a different shell!   Pretty neat huh?  Finally I added a Lil' Inkers Designs sentiment to make it into an encouragement card.

Twofer Feathers


Hi there!

I was determined to play along with Darnell's new Twofer Challenge and as usual am squeaking in at the last minute.  I used my Simon Says Stamp feather dies to make a wedding card and an encouragement card.  For the wedding card I used the negative die cuts and decorated them with Nuvo Crystal Drops.  For the encouragement card I die cut the feathers from patterned papers.
